6 Benefits of Green Tea for Beauty

There are many benefits of green tea for beauty that can be obtained by drinking it or applying it to the skin and hair. This is because green tea contains a variety of nutrients and is rich in antioxidants.

Green tea comes from the tea plant Camellia sinensis which is processed by drying and can be processed into a drink. Not only nutritious for the health of the body, but green tea is also good for beauty.

These various properties cannot be separated from the various nutrients contained in this plant. The following are some types of nutrients in green tea:

  • B vitamins
  • Vitamin C
  • Vitamin E
  • Calcium
  • Magnesium
  • Manganese
  • Zinc
  • selenium

Green tea is also rich in polyphenol antioxidants and EGCG ( epigallocatechin gallate). It is a shame to miss these various ingredients in green tea because they play a role in maintaining a healthy body and skin.

Some of the Benefits of Green Tea for Beauty

To get the benefits of green tea for beauty, you can consume it as a drink or use skin care products that contain green tea extracts, such as moisturizers, creams, and serums.

Some of the beauty benefits of green tea include:

1. Prevent and repair skin damage

The content of epigallocatechin gallate in green tea can function as a natural sunscreen that protects the skin from the effects of UV rays, naturally whitens the skin, and protects body cells from damage caused by exposure to free radicals.

Some research also states that green tea extract can prevent and inhibit the growth of cancer cells, including skin cancer.

Some skin care products that contain green tea extract are also efficacious for hydrating the skin, so the skin will look softer and maintain its flexibility.

2. Prevent premature aging 

Vitamin C contained in green tea is believed to increase collagen production. This substance is a protein that plays an important role in maintaining skin elasticity. In addition, the antioxidants in green tea can also prevent premature aging of your skin.

Therefore, not a few skincare and beauty products use green tea extract to treat and prevent skin problems, such as wrinkles, spots or dark spots on the skin, and dull skin.

3. Soothes the skin

You can also use green tea as a natural skin conditioner. The trick is to cool the green tea bag in the refrigerator for a few minutes, then compress the skin area. This cold compress can also relieve pain and redness on sunburned skin.

The anti-inflammatory properties of green tea can have a cooling effect on the skin while preventing cell damage due to sun exposure.

4. Overcoming panda eyes or eye bags

Lack of rest can cause the body to feel tired and appearance of eye bags or panda eyes. Well, using cold compresses from green tea bags can reduce swelling in the eyes due to lack of sleep or rest.

5. Treating acne

Several studies state that the use of green tea extract to drink or apply to the skin can reduce the bumps caused by acne. The polyphenol content in green tea has been shown to reduce sebum production in the oil glands which triggers acne.

6. Overcoming hair loss problems

Besides being able to overcome skin disorders, the antioxidant and vitamin content in green tea is believed to be able to stimulate hair growth. Some research shows that green tea extract appears to nourish hair and prevent damage to the scalp that causes hair loss.

You can feel the maximum benefits of green tea for beauty if accompanied by a healthy diet, regular exercise, adequate rest, and not smoking.

To get the various benefits of green tea for beauty above, you can consume green tea or use skin care products that contain green tea.
